mike I think your talking about the 99-01 cobras...they were horrible on the dyno's and were having real problems putting up decent #'s. In 2002 they didnt even produce a cobra expect for a few in ausie land. In 2003 the cam back with a car that was actually under rated from the factory instead of over rated.
If the new cobra is anything like the 03-05 models we are prolly looking at 430 or so rwhp factory stock with gobs of tq. Not bad even with the weight oh which I highly doubt its going to be 3800 or even 3900 as some have quoted.
Old 03-05 coupes are 3500 and verts are 3700. I highly doubt there are going to gain 400lbs for the coupe....just dont see it happening.
430rwhp and 3500lbs.....might not turn well...but, man dont mess with him on the freeway.
